mc-imperial / jfs
Constraint solver based on coverage-guided fuzzing
☆240Updated last year
Alternatives and similar repositories for jfs:
Users that are interested in jfs are comparing it to the libraries listed below
- KLEE / CSE Project☆43Updated 4 years ago
- Experimental translation of llvm to smt.☆56Updated 4 years ago
- Seeding fuzzers with symbolic execution☆201Updated 7 years ago
- A new context, field, and array-sensitive heap analysis for LLVM bitcode based on DSA.☆163Updated 7 months ago
- Static Slicer for LLVM☆66Updated 9 years ago
- Compiler-assisted Code Randomization (CCR) Toolchain☆59Updated 2 years ago
- APISan: Sanitizing API Usages through Semantic Cross-Checking☆63Updated 3 years ago
- Program analysis tools developed at Draper on the CBAT project.☆102Updated last year
- CRETE under development☆59Updated 4 years ago
- FairFuzz: AFL extension targeting rare branches☆242Updated 5 years ago
- A survey by the SEASON lab on symbolic execution tools and techniques. The survey has appeared in ACM CSUR in 2018.☆81Updated 6 years ago
- UFO: Predictive Detection of Concurrency Use-After-Free Vulnerabilities☆32Updated 4 years ago
- Timeless debugging with symbolic execution and processor trace☆74Updated 4 years ago
- Coverage-guided grammar aware fuzzer that uses grammar automatons☆65Updated 3 years ago
- Sys: A Static/Symbolic Tool for Finding Good Bugs in Good (Browser) Code☆224Updated 2 years ago
- Modular And Compositional analysis with KLEE Engine☆114Updated 5 years ago
- source code for savior fuzzer☆126Updated 4 years ago
- UniSan: Proactive Kernel Memory Initialization to Eliminate Data Leakages☆42Updated 3 years ago
- Configurable instrumentation of LLVM bitcode☆33Updated 2 months ago
- A tool to manage, conduct, and assess dictionary-based fuzz testing☆64Updated 7 years ago
- git://g.csail.mit.edu/kint☆49Updated 11 years ago
- Detecting Spectre vulnerabilities using symbolic execution, built on angr (github.com/angr/angr)☆75Updated 2 years ago
- AFL++ as a library: gives you all the tools necessary to craft the best fuzzer for your targets with ease!☆112Updated 3 years ago
- Replication package for Mining Input Grammars From Dynamic Control Flow☆24Updated 4 years ago
- Dynamic Program Slicing in LLVM Compiler☆136Updated 6 years ago
- Utilities for generating dynamic traces☆89Updated 2 years ago
- ☆40Updated 4 years ago
- KLEE Symbolic Execution Engine☆60Updated 5 years ago
- Symbiotic is a tool for finding bugs in computer programs based on instrumentation, program slicing and KLEE☆315Updated 2 months ago
- Ankou: Guiding Grey-box Fuzzing towards Combinatorial Difference (ICSE '20)☆54Updated 4 years ago